Company Overview

LendingPad, Corp. 7901 Jones Branch Drive, McLean, VA 22102

LendingPad is a fast-growing Loan Origination System (LOS) built for the modern mortgage institution. The suite of products include a point of sale (POS), compliance engine, document solution, API, and other mortgage-origination related products. Our goal is to provide a scalable, efficient, and compliant software solution to meet the needs of today's demands.

We are seeking a detail-oriented and technically proficient QA & Test Engineer to join our innovative team. The ideal candidate will have experience in testing financial applications, particularly mortgage origination, servicing, or underwriting platforms. You will be responsible for ensuring the reliability, accuracy, and compliance of our mortgage software solutions through rigorous testing and validation.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in software testing, preferably in the mortgage or financial services domain
  • Strong understanding of mortgage lifecycle processes (origination, underwriting, closing, servicing)
  • Experience with test management tools and defect tracking systems
  • Familiarity with automation testing tools and scripting languages
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ills
  • Knowledge of regulatory compliance in mortgage lending
  • Strong grasp of logic and pseudocode
  • Analytical stills bridging legal research and rule-based logic
  • Skilled in independent test case design and execution
  • Thorough bug reporting and documentation
  • Strong work ethics, a passion for excellence and a desire to continuously learn
  • Exceptional multi-tasking abilities and a high level of organization to man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Polite and professional attitude
  • ISTQB or equivalent certification is preferred

Education

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field preferred

Duties

  • Develop, execute, and maintain test plans, test cases, and test scripts for LOS, compliance and related software applications
  • Perform functional, regression, integration, and user acceptance testing (UAT)
  • Collaborate with developers and product managers to understand requirements and ensure test coverage
  • Identify, document, and track software defects using issue tracking tools
  • Validate compliance with mortgage industry standards and regulations (e.g., RESPA, TRID, HMDA)
  • Participate in Agile process and contribute to continuous improvement of QA processes
  • Conduct data validation and backend testing using SQL or other database tools
  • Assist in automation testing efforts
